Course Content

• Water Conservation in Green Building Design
• Understanding Water Audits & Water Use Reduction Strategies
• Low-Impact Development (LID) Techniques for Green Spaces
• Greywater Recycling and Reuse Systems
• Rainwater Harvesting and Management
• Xeriscaping and Drought-Tolerant Landscaping
• Water-Efficient Fixtures and Appliances
• Green Building Certification & Water Conservation Standards (LEED, etc.)

Career path

Career Role Description
Green Building Water Conservation Engineer Designs and implements water-efficient systems for buildings, minimizing environmental impact. High demand for sustainability skills.
Sustainable Water Management Consultant (Green Building) Advises construction firms and building owners on water conservation strategies, reducing water waste and costs. Strong market growth predicted.
Water Efficiency Auditor (Green Building Focus) Conducts audits to identify and assess water usage in buildings, suggesting improvements for better efficiency. Essential role in green building certification.
Renewable Water Harvesting Technician Installs and maintains rainwater harvesting systems in buildings, promoting sustainable water practices. Growing sector with high future potential.
